SELECT SQL_CALC_FOUND_ROWS SQL_NO_CACHE `mediatypes`.`mtID` AS `mediaTypeID`,IF(`mediatypes`.`mtCode`="profiles", CONCAT(`users`.`userDisplayName`, " / ", `media`.`mediaTitle`), `media`.`mediaTitle`) AS `name`,`media`.`mediaTitle` AS `title`,`users`.`userDisplayName` AS `displayname`,`mediatypes`.`mtCode` AS `media`,IF(REPLACE(REPLACE(REPLACE(REPLACE(REPLACE(REPLACE(REPLACE(IF(CHAR_LENGTH(`media`.`mediaText`)>220, CONCAT(SUBSTRING(`media`.`mediaText`, 1, 220), "..."), `media`.`mediaText`), "\r", ""), "\n", " "), "&", "&"), "\"", """), "\'", "'"), "<", "<"), ">", ">")="", "", REPLACE(REPLACE(REPLACE(REPLACE(REPLACE(REPLACE(REPLACE(IF(CHAR_LENGTH(`media`.`mediaText`)>220, CONCAT(SUBSTRING(`media`.`mediaText`, 1, 220), "..."), `media`.`mediaText`), "\r", ""), "\n", " "), "&", "&"), "\"", """), "\'", "'"), "<", "<"), ">", ">")) AS `text`,IF(`media`.`mediaFile`!="" AND `mediatypes`.`mtImage`+`mediatypes`.`mtVideo`!=0, CONCAT("media/", `networkAlias`, "/", `mediatypes`.`mtCode`, "/", IF(`mediatypes`.`mtVideo`=1, SUBSTRING(`media`.`mediaFile`, 1, LOCATE(".", `media`.`mediaFile`)-1), `media`.`mediaFile`)), (SELECT IF(`avatar`.`mediaFile`!="", CONCAT("media/", `networkAlias`, "/", `avatarmt`.`mtCode`, "/", `avatar`.`mediaFile`), "") FROM `media` AS `avatar`, `mediatypes` AS `avatarmt` WHERE `avatar`.`mediaUser`=`media`.`mediaUser` AND `avatar`.`mediaType`=`avatarmt`.`mtID` AND `avatarmt`.`mtCode`="profiles" LIMIT 1)) AS `image`,CONCAT("/", `users`.`userSeoName`, "/") AS `pubHref`,CONCAT("/", `users`.`userSeoName`, "/", IF(`mediatypes`.`mtCode`="profiles", "", CONCAT(`media`.`mediaSeoName`, "/")), "?network%5B0%5D=9&month=12&view=list") AS `href`,CONCAT("https://", `networkUrl`, "/", `users`.`userSeoName`, "/", IF(`mediatypes`.`mtCode`="profiles", "", CONCAT(`media`.`mediaSeoName`, "/"))) AS `abshref`,CASE WHEN `users`.`userNetwork`=9 AND `users`.`userElevation`>=99 THEN "special" WHEN `mediatypes`.`mtCode` IS NULL OR `mediatypes`.`mtCode`="profiles" THEN `users`.`userType` ELSE `mediatypes`.`mtCode` END AS `class`,IF(`mediatypes`.`mtDate`=1, IF(`mediatypes`.`mtDateEnd`=0 OR `media`.`mediaDateEnd`=`media`.`mediaDate`, DATE_FORMAT(`media`.`mediaDate`, "%a %d %b %Y"), CONCAT(DATE_FORMAT(`media`.`mediaDate`, CASE WHEN DATE_FORMAT(`media`.`mediaDate`, "%Y%m")=DATE_FORMAT(`media`.`mediaDateEnd`, "%Y%m") THEN "%a %d" WHEN DATE_FORMAT(`media`.`mediaDate`, "%Y")=DATE_FORMAT(`media`.`mediaDateEnd`, "%Y") THEN "%a %d %b" ELSE "%a %d %b %Y" END), " to ", DATE_FORMAT(`media`.`mediaDateEnd`, "%a %d %b %Y"), " (", CASE WHEN DATEDIFF(`media`.`mediaDateEnd`, `media`.`mediaDate`)+1<7 THEN CONCAT(DATEDIFF(`media`.`mediaDateEnd`, `media`.`mediaDate`)+1, " days") WHEN DATEDIFF(`media`.`mediaDateEnd`, `media`.`mediaDate`)+1<=28 THEN CONCAT(ROUND((DATEDIFF(`media`.`mediaDateEnd`, `media`.`mediaDate`)+1)/7), IF(ROUND((DATEDIFF(`media`.`mediaDateEnd`, `media`.`mediaDate`)+1)/7)=1, " week", " weeks")) WHEN DATEDIFF(`media`.`mediaDateEnd`, `media`.`mediaDate`)+1<365 THEN CONCAT(ROUND((DATEDIFF(`media`.`mediaDateEnd`, `media`.`mediaDate`)+1)/30.417), IF(ROUND((DATEDIFF(`media`.`mediaDateEnd`, `media`.`mediaDate`)+1)/30.417)=1, " month", " months")) ELSE CONCAT(ROUND((DATEDIFF(`media`.`mediaDateEnd`, `media`.`mediaDate`)+1)/365), IF(DATEDIFF(`media`.`mediaDateEnd`, `media`.`mediaDate`)+1<730, " year", " years")) END, ")")), "") AS `date`,`media`.`mediaDate` AS `rssdate`,DATE_FORMAT(`media`.`mediaDate`, "%Y-%m-%dT%TZ") AS `isodate`,IF(`mediatypes`.`mtCode`="profiles", CONCAT(UPPER(SUBSTRING(`userType`, 1, 1)), SUBSTRING(`userType`, 2)), `mediatypes`.`mtName`) AS `type`,((IF(`weightingCreated`>0 AND `media`.`mediaCreated`!="0000-00-00" AND `media`.`mediaCreated` BETWEEN "2019-04-26" AND "2019-10-11", ((1.1904761904762*(84-IF(`media`.`mediaCreated`>"2019-07-19", DATEDIFF(`media`.`mediaCreated`, "2019-07-19"), DATEDIFF("2019-07-19", `media`.`mediaCreated`)))))*`weightingCreated`, 0))+(IF(`weightingUpdated`>0 AND `media`.`mediaUpdated`!="0000-00-00" AND `media`.`mediaUpdated` BETWEEN "2019-04-26" AND "2019-10-11", ((1.1904761904762*(84-IF(`media`.`mediaUpdated`>"2019-07-19", DATEDIFF(`media`.`mediaUpdated`, "2019-07-19"), DATEDIFF("2019-07-19", `media`.`mediaUpdated`)))))*`weightingUpdated`, 0))+(IF(`weightingProfileupdated`>0 AND `userLastUpdate`!="0000-00-00" AND `userLastUpdate` BETWEEN "2019-04-26" AND "2019-10-11", ((1.1904761904762*(84-IF(`userLastUpdate`>"2019-07-19", DATEDIFF(`userLastUpdate`, "2019-07-19"), DATEDIFF("2019-07-19", `userLastUpdate`)))))*`weightingProfileupdated`, 0))+(IF(`weightingDate`>0 AND IF(`mediatypes`.`mtDateEnd`=0 OR `media`.`mediaDateEnd`="0000-00-00", `media`.`mediaDate`, IF("2019-07-19" BETWEEN `media`.`mediaDate` AND `media`.`mediaDateEnd`, "2019-07-19", IF(`media`.`mediaDate`>"2019-07-19", `media`.`mediaDate`, `media`.`mediaDateEnd`)))!="0000-00-00" AND IF(`mediatypes`.`mtDateEnd`=0 OR `media`.`mediaDateEnd`="0000-00-00", `media`.`mediaDate`, IF("2019-07-19" BETWEEN `media`.`mediaDate` AND `media`.`mediaDateEnd`, "2019-07-19", IF(`media`.`mediaDate`>"2019-07-19", `media`.`mediaDate`, `media`.`mediaDateEnd`))) BETWEEN "2019-04-26" AND "2019-10-11", ((1.1904761904762*(84-IF(IF(`mediatypes`.`mtDateEnd`=0 OR `media`.`mediaDateEnd`="0000-00-00", `media`.`mediaDate`, IF("2019-07-19" BETWEEN `media`.`mediaDate` AND `media`.`mediaDateEnd`, "2019-07-19", IF(`media`.`mediaDate`>"2019-07-19", `media`.`mediaDate`, `media`.`mediaDateEnd`)))>"2019-07-19", DATEDIFF(IF(`mediatypes`.`mtDateEnd`=0 OR `media`.`mediaDateEnd`="0000-00-00", `media`.`mediaDate`, IF("2019-07-19" BETWEEN `media`.`mediaDate` AND `media`.`mediaDateEnd`, "2019-07-19", IF(`media`.`mediaDate`>"2019-07-19", `media`.`mediaDate`, `media`.`mediaDateEnd`))), "2019-07-19"), DATEDIFF("2019-07-19", IF(`mediatypes`.`mtDateEnd`=0 OR `media`.`mediaDateEnd`="0000-00-00", `media`.`mediaDate`, IF("2019-07-19" BETWEEN `media`.`mediaDate` AND `media`.`mediaDateEnd`, "2019-07-19", IF(`media`.`mediaDate`>"2019-07-19", `media`.`mediaDate`, `media`.`mediaDateEnd`))))))))*`weightingDate`, 0))+(IF(`weightingDuration`>0 AND `mediatypes`.`mtDate`=1 AND `mediatypes`.`mtDateEnd`=1 AND IF(`mtFuture`=1, DATEDIFF(`media`.`mediaDateEnd`, `media`.`mediaDate`), DATEDIFF(`media`.`mediaDate`, `media`.`mediaDateEnd`)) BETWEEN 0 AND 365, (100-((100/365)*IF(`mtFuture`=1, DATEDIFF(`media`.`mediaDateEnd`, `media`.`mediaDate`), DATEDIFF(`media`.`mediaDate`, `media`.`mediaDateEnd`))))*`weightingDuration`, 0))+(IF(`weightingProximity`>0 AND (3959*ACOS(COS(RADIANS(53.644394))*COS(RADIANS(IFNULL(`media`.`mediaLatitude`, `userLatitude`)))*COS(RADIANS(IFNULL(`media`.`mediaLongitude`, `userLongitude`))-RADIANS(-1.784605))+SIN(RADIANS(53.644394))*SIN(RADIANS(IFNULL(`media`.`mediaLatitude`, `userLatitude`)))))<100, (IF((3959*ACOS(COS(RADIANS(53.644394))*COS(RADIANS(IFNULL(`media`.`mediaLatitude`, `userLatitude`)))*COS(RADIANS(IFNULL(`media`.`mediaLongitude`, `userLongitude`))-RADIANS(-1.784605))+SIN(RADIANS(53.644394))*SIN(RADIANS(IFNULL(`media`.`mediaLatitude`, `userLatitude`)))))<10, 100, 100-(100/(3959*ACOS(COS(RADIANS(53.644394))*COS(RADIANS(IFNULL(`media`.`mediaLatitude`, `userLatitude`)))*COS(RADIANS(IFNULL(`media`.`mediaLongitude`, `userLongitude`))-RADIANS(-1.784605))+SIN(RADIANS(53.644394))*SIN(RADIANS(IFNULL(`media`.`mediaLatitude`, `userLatitude`))))))))*`weightingProximity`, 0))+(IF(`weightingSpecial`>0 AND `userNetwork`=9 AND `userElevation`>0, (`userElevation`)*`weightingSpecial`, 0))+(IF(`weightingTotalitems`>0 AND `userTotalItems`>0, ((100/0)*IF(`userTotalItems`>0, 0, `userTotalItems`))*`weightingTotalitems`, 0))+(IF(`weightingMediaviews`>0 AND `media`.`mediaViews`>0, ((100/515)*`media`.`mediaViews`)*`weightingMediaviews`, 0))+(IF(`weightingProfileviews`>0 AND `userProfileViews`>0, ((100/227)*`userProfileViews`)*`weightingProfileviews`, 0)))/(`weightingCreated`+`weightingUpdated`+`weightingProfileupdated`+`weightingDate`+`weightingDuration`+`weightingProximity`+`weightingSpecial`+`weightingTotalitems`+`weightingMediaviews`+`weightingProfileviews`) AS `relevance` FROM `media`, `users`, `mediatypes`, `networks`, `weightings` WHERE `media`.`mediaActive`=1 AND `media`.`mediaEncoding`=0 AND `media`.`mediaApproved`=1 AND `userID`=`media`.`mediaUser` AND `networkID`=`userNetwork` AND `userPublish`=1 AND `userActive`=1 AND `mediatypes`.`mtID`=`media`.`mediaType` AND `weightingNetwork`=9 AND `weightingType`=`media`.`mediaType` AND `mediatypes`.`mtID`=3 AND `userNetwork` IN (9) AND DATE_FORMAT(`media`.`mediaDate`, '%Y%m') = 201912 GROUP BY `media`.`mediaID` ORDER BY `relevance` DESC LIMIT 0, 15;
What's on in Kirklees, West Yorkshire / Events / December 2019 / 1 to 15 of 15

What's On

Find out about arts, cultural and creative events in Kirklees, West Yorkshire - covering Huddersfield, Holmfirth, Dewsbury, Batley and surrounding areas. 

SIGN UP TO OUR NEWSLETTER
Keep up-to-date with the latest events
. (N
ote: event information is added by the organiser who is responsible for its accuracy).  For more information about places to visit and stay in the area go to Visit Kirklees.

To add arts or creative events, register, set up your creative profile and start adding your events

Events / December 2019 / 1 to 15 of 15

Upcoming / Today / Jul / Aug / Sep / Oct / Nov / Dec / Jan / Feb / Mar / Apr / May / Jun / Archive

1st / 2nd / 3rd / 4th / 5th / 6th / 7th / 8th / 9th / 10th / 11th / 12th

Brass Band Christmas Concert

Wed 11 Dec 2019

Brass Band Christmas Concert

Christmas with all the trimmings in one bite-sized concert: the University of Huddersfield Brass Band treats you to a collection of holiday classics, Yuletide greats and audience carols too. Festive feel-good within o.....Read more

Orchestra of Opera North: The Nutcracker & The Snowman

Wed 11 Dec 2019

Orchestra of Opera North: The Nutcracker & The Snowman

An enchanting tale told through music, narration and hand-drawn illustrations. On Christmas Eve, Clara is gifted with the most beautiful toy, a nutcracker. Falling asleep with the toy in her arms, she dreams of a world o.....Read more

Orchestra of Opera North: Christmas Concert

Thu 12 Dec 2019

Orchestra of Opera North: Christmas Concert

Heavenly voices and beloved orchestral pieces are a wonderful addition to your Christmas festivities as the Orchestra of Opera North, joined on stage by the massed voices of the company’s Chorus and Youth Chorus, captiva.....Read more

Orchestra of Opera North: Viennese Whirl

Mon 30 Dec 2019

Orchestra of Opera North: Viennese Whirl

A winter wonderland of waltzes, polkas and marches. Join us for a glittering programme of orchestral pyrotechnics to see out the old year and welcome the new in spectacular style. Inspired by Vienna’s traditional .....Read more

Gordon Stewart celebrates Andrew Carter's 80th Birthday

Mon 02 Dec 2019

Gordon Stewart celebrates Andrew Carter's 80th Birthday

Composer, choral director, singer, teacher and bell-ringer, Andrew Carter's contribution to the musical life of Yorkshire is boundless, and his choral works have been produced all over the world. In this celebratory conc.....Read more

Brass Band Christmas Spectacular

Mon 09 Dec 2019

Brass Band Christmas Spectacular

We're delighted to welcome back the University of Huddersfield Brass Band for this jamboree of Christmas classics and audience carols. A firm favourite for many, this concert is the perfect respite from the hustle and.....Read more

Music for Christmas

Mon 23 Dec 2019

Music for Christmas

Back by popular demand, Gordon Stewart is joined by Huddersfield Boys' and Girls' Choirs in a programme of Christmas music from round the world. The organ solos include pieces by Bach, Aaron Shows and Robert Cockroft. .....Read more

Are You Experienced? Europe's No1 Jimi Hendrix tribute

Sat 07 Dec 2019

Are You Experienced? Europe's No1 Jimi Hendrix tribute

ARE YOU EXPERIENCED? are now in their 22nd year, and during that time they have become widely regarded as one of the best tribute shows on the circuit. Guitarist John Campbell bears more than just a passing resemblanc.....Read more

Sat 07 Dec 2019

Christmas Concert

Joint Christmas Concert, Denby Dale Ladies' Choir and Thurlstone Band. Starts 7.15 pm...Read more

Sun 15 Dec 2019

Christmas concert

Joint Concert: Denby Dale Ladies' and Skelmanthorpe Male Voice choirs perform a medley of Christmas carols and songs. Starts: 2.30 pm...Read more

Byram Arcade Craft Fair - Dec

Sun 08 Dec 2019

Byram Arcade Craft Fair - Dec

The craft fair at the amazing Victorian Byram Arcade is back every second Sunday of the month 10am - 4pm. Good news if you don't have your own public liability insurance, I can now arrange stall cover for this event, .....Read more

Felting Workshop at The Peppercorn - Dec

Thu 05 Dec 2019

Felting Workshop at The Peppercorn - Dec

Come and enjoy felting at the lovely Vegan Peppercorn café which is open at 6.30pm prior to the workshop for food, cakes, and other goodies. Workshop 7 -9pm All felting supplies provided £15 per person. Needle Felte.....Read more

Christmas Comedy Cellar

Wed 18 to Thu 19 Dec 2019 (2 days)

Christmas Comedy Cellar

Join us for an evening of ho-ho-hilarity at Huddersfield’s premiere comedy night. Acts this Christmas: Tom Wrigglesworth From Russell Howard’s Good News, Edinburgh Comedy Fest and Electric Dreams. Sony Award winner f.....Read more

The Krumpus

Wed 11 to Sun 29 Dec 2019 (3 weeks)

The Krumpus

A Fierce Fairytale by Nikita Gill. Alice knows at Christmas if you’ve been good you receive presents and if you’re naughty to expect a lump of coal. She had heard stories of monsters under the bed but didn’t really b.....Read more

Sleeping Beauty

Fri 06 Dec 2019 to Sun 05 Jan 2020 (1 month)

Sleeping Beauty

Andrew Pollard Director: Joyce Branagh Book before 31 January and get 10% off full price tickets! Go on a magical adventure with our new pantomime Sleeping Beauty! From the team who brought you Aladdin and Jack.....Read more